Key Applications
Rubber and Plastics Industry
As a crucial silane coupling agent, 3-chloropropylmethyldimethoxysilane enhances the mechanical properties and processing of rubber and plastic compounds by improving filler dispersion and polymer-matrix adhesion.
Textile Treatment
In the textile sector, this organosilane acts as a finishing agent, potentially improving fabric properties like durability, water repellency, and dye uptake, contributing to higher-value textile products.
Adhesives and Sealants
The ability of 3-chloropropylmethyldimethoxysilane to promote adhesion makes it a valuable additive in adhesive and sealant formulations, ensuring stronger and more durable bonds in construction and automotive applications.
Chemical Synthesis Intermediate
This compound serves as a fundamental intermediate in the synthesis of a wide array of organofunctional silanes, enabling the creation of bespoke materials for specialized industrial and research purposes.
